WebMemory is the set of processes used to encode, store, and retrieve information over different periods of time. Encoding We get information into our brains through a process called encoding, which is the input of information into the memory system. Once we receive sensory information from the environment, our brains label or code it. The terms short-term and working memory are sometimes used … Web10 mrt. 2024 · Memories are Stored in our Brains. Our brains are little mazes of brain cells called neurons. The human brain is composed of around 100 billion neurons. If neurons were the size of a grain of sand (they are actually much smaller!) we could fill around 8,500 soda cans with neurons from one single human brain.
